Talk in brief

Gabriela Ospina presents Object-Oriented UX (OOUX) and the ORCA process as a way to understand a complex product before drawing screens. The approach starts with the nouns in a domain—the people, places, and things users recognize—rather than beginning with task flows. Teams then map relationships between those objects, identify the actions each object offers to different user roles, and define the content and metadata that make each object meaningful. The result is an object map: a shared model that can expose unanswered business rules, guide navigation, inform data structures, and show what a page must contain. Ospina’s argument is not that ORCA replaces research or an existing product process. It supplies structured questions between research and interface design, allowing product, design, engineering, content, and data partners to resolve uncertainty together and reduce costly rework later.

The gap between research and screens

Ospina describes design as the management of complexity. Research may reveal a problem, but teams still face structural questions before a solution is ready for interface design. Under pressure to show progress, designers often begin drawing screens while simultaneously deciding content, navigation, and business rules. That creates hidden multitasking. The alternative proposed here is to make the system explicit first and invite the product-creation team to answer the difficult questions together.

Objects before tasks

Object-Oriented UX begins with the nouns in the user’s mental model. A social product contains people, posts, messages, comments, jobs, or recommendations; a delivery product contains consumers, couriers, venues, menus, items, and orders. These objects are not UI components. They are the things users and the business care about. Identifying and defining them exposes ambiguity early—for example, whether two similar nouns are truly the same object or follow different rules.

Mapping relationships and cardinality

The second ORCA question asks how the objects connect. A nested object matrix records whether one object must, may, or may not have another. That model can reveal natural nested navigation, empty states that are or are not possible, and data relationships engineers will eventually need. The value is not the diagram itself; it is the conversation it makes possible before the team invests in finished designs or discovers contradictions during development.

Actions belong to objects and roles

The call-to-action matrix lists what different user roles may do with each object. A consumer, merchant, and support employee may have different actions on the same venue, menu item, or order. The team then asks why the action exists, when it should be available, and what prerequisite or context applies. Tying actions to objects helps users find available behavior and prevents important interactions from being scattered across unrelated parts of the interface.

Content and metadata form the object map

Attributes describe what makes an object recognizable. ORCA separates core content—such as a unique name, image, or description—from metadata that may support sorting, filtering, or grouping. Adding attributes and actions to the relationship model produces an object map, a high-level view of the system. Teams can prioritize what appears in a compact card and what remains one click away, then create wireframes with confidence about what each screen represents.

A tool inside the existing process

ORCA is presented as a tool, not a replacement for research or delivery practice. Teams can begin with the question they currently cannot answer, reverse-engineer existing screens to recover their objects, or document a complex domain for future contributors. The model helps product disciplines share language and gives newcomers a durable explanation of the system. Its intended outcome is less guesswork, earlier collaboration, and interfaces that reflect the way users understand the domain.
